Hermann Armin von Kern – A Painter of Everyday Life

Hermann Armin von Kern (14 March 1838 – 18 January 1912) stands as a prominent figure in Austrian art history, celebrated for his masterful depictions of domestic scenes and portraits that captured the spirit of his era. Born in Idrija, Slovenia—then part of Austro-Hungarian Empire—Kern’s artistic journey began amidst the rich cultural landscape of Habsburg rule, shaping his distinctive style and thematic concerns. He pursued formal training at the Akademie der Bildenden Künste Wien (Vienna Academy of Fine Arts), honing his skills under influential instructors and immersing himself in the prevailing artistic currents of the time.
  • Early Influences: Kern’s formative years were marked by exposure to Romanticism, particularly landscapes infused with emotion and dramatic lighting—a stylistic element that would subtly permeate his later works.
  • Academic Training & Vienna Academy: Studying at Vienna Academy solidified Kern's commitment to realism and established him within the artistic establishment of the Austro-Hungarian Empire. He diligently practiced classical techniques, mastering oil painting and achieving exceptional precision in anatomical rendering.
Kern’s oeuvre is characterized by an unwavering dedication to portraying scenes from ordinary life—the kitchen interior, family gatherings, portraits of individuals engaged in their daily activities. Unlike many artists of his time who favored grand historical narratives or mythological subjects, Kern focused on capturing the nuances of human experience within familiar surroundings. This deliberate choice reflects a broader artistic trend toward psychological realism and an interest in conveying emotional depth through subtle gestures and expressions.
  • Signature Style: His canvases are imbued with meticulous detail—from the textures of fabrics to the reflections in polished surfaces—creating immersive environments that transport viewers into the heart of domestic life.
  • Notable Works: Among his most celebrated paintings include “The Botanist’s Tipple,” a captivating portrayal of a gentleman surrounded by plants and scientific instruments, exemplifying Kern's fascination with observation and accuracy. Similarly, "The Maestro" showcases a musician absorbed in his craft, capturing the artist's inner world with remarkable sensitivity.
Kern gained considerable renown during his lifetime, securing commissions from aristocratic families and serving as court painter to Franz Josef I—a position that afforded him access to influential circles and ensured the dissemination of his art throughout Vienna’s cultural elite. His paintings were exhibited extensively in Viennese salons and garnered critical acclaim for their realism and emotional resonance. Today, Kern's works reside primarily in museums like the Von der Heydt Museum in Braunschweig, Germany, where they continue to inspire admiration for their ability to convey timeless themes of family, tradition, and human connection. He remains a testament to the power of art to illuminate the beauty and complexity of everyday life—a legacy that resonates powerfully with audiences encountering his paintings anew.

Informações Rápidas

  • Artistic Movement Or Style: Genre Painting
  • Date Of Birth: March 14, 1838
  • Date Of Death: January 18, 1912
  • Full Name: Hermann Armin von Kern
  • Nationality: Austrian
  • Notable Artworks:
    • Kitchen Interior
    • The Maestro
    • Grandmother With Playing Grandchildren
  • Place Of Birth: Idrija, Slovenia
